New Admiral B2 "high speed" motor installed- no faster
I just finished installing a new motor, lift kit, and 23" tires, and my cart is no faster than before.
Last year, I installed a 400 amp alltrax XCT, 2 ga. wires, and 7 new batteries (I upgraded to 42v). At that time, for the money I spent, I was disappointed to have only increased from 18mph to 20mph. Now, with the motor and tires I only got about another 3mph. Anybody have any ideas? I have screenshots of controller settings and monitor page while out driving. The motor is only reaching about 4400rpm. (Limit set at 6K). I read some old threads from JohnnieB saying that going from 36v to 42v and adding the 400 amp alltrax should have yielded around 29mph last year... I never got even close. If I don't start seeing results, my wife is going to stop letting me spend the money! |

Re: New Admiral B2 "high speed" motor installed- no faster
Sorry, I don't have any help for you but I will tell you that I have the same cart you have and it will do 24-25 mph on 36V with the stock PDS motor. You should definitely be faster than 20 mph. Check your brakes to see if they are dragging. Just try to push it and see how easy it rolls.

Re: New Admiral B2 "high speed" motor installed- no faster
I checked the brakes already. I actually just installed a brand new rear end (ClubCar conversion for EZGO). Between the new rear and the lift kit, I had to adjust the brakes a little. At first, they were actually too loose.
What RPM is your stock motor turning to do 25mph? I could never get it to turn faster than around 4000. I'm thinking there is something wrong with my controller settings that's not allowing the motor to get full power. Hoping someone can help! |
